What you will study

Program Description This conversion course is delivered by the Business School, which has AACSB accreditation in recognition of Bournemouth University's focus on excellence in all areas. It’s something that fewer than 5% of business schools worldwide have achieved, so students can be sure they're in good hands. This course is also accredited by the Institute of Direct and Digital Marketing (IDM) which means students may be eligible to sit an extra exam to achieve the IDM Professional Certificate alongside their degree.

Digital and technical skills are highly sought after by a wide range of professionals. User experience designers are increasingly being asked to demonstrate social science skills and business acumen, as well as technical knowledge.

This course aims to provide students with a deeper knowledge of marketing combined with the technical skills to design and manage the user experience – the combination of which will make graduates highly employable.

Students will be introduced to a range of digital marketing concepts and integrated marketing communication campaigns, as well as learning how to design and develop digital products, services and solutions by applying human centred design principles and techniques. Students will also explore the psychological theories of decision making and behaviour change and design methods for persuasive technology.

This course will suit those with a background in business, management or marketing, computer science or information and technology management who wish to advance and reorient their marketing and user experience skills, knowledge and techniques. Students will also have the option to complete a 30-week work placement with a UX employer to help increase their employability even further.
